The Significance of 'esp'

The segment 'esp' is particularly interesting because it is a widely recognized abbreviation. In the automotive industry, 'ESP' typically stands for Electronic Stability Program. This is a safety feature that helps prevent skidding and loss of control by automatically intervening when it detects a potential loss of traction. If the string 'oscjvk1166zsc esp' is associated with a vehicle or automotive component, it's highly likely that 'esp' refers to this system. However, 'esp' can also have other meanings. In some contexts, it stands for Español, the Spanish language. This is common in software, hardware, and other products that offer multilingual support. If the string is related to a software application or a device with language options, 'esp' might indicate the Spanish language version. To determine the correct meaning, consider the context in which you found the string. If it's related to a car or a car part, 'Electronic Stability Program' is the most likely interpretation. If it's related to software or a device with language options, 'Español' is more likely. It's also possible that 'esp' is an abbreviation for something else entirely. In some cases, it could be a company-specific code or an acronym for a technical term. Strategies for Deciphering Unknown Strings

When faced with an unknown string like 'oscjvk1166zsc esp', it's essential to have a systematic approach to deciphering it. Here are some strategies you can use:

  1. Search Online: The first and most straightforward approach is to search for the string online. Use search engines like Google, Bing, or DuckDuckGo, and try different variations of the string. You might find references to it in forums, product listings, technical documentation, or other online resources.
  2. Break Down the String: As we did earlier, break the string down into smaller segments and try to decipher each segment individually. Look for patterns, abbreviations, or common codes that might provide clues about the meaning of each segment.
  3. Consider the Context: Pay close attention to the context in which you found the string. The location, surrounding information, and associated product or system can all provide valuable clues about its meaning.
  4. Consult Documentation: If the string is associated with a specific product or system, consult its documentation. Look for manuals, technical specifications, configuration guides, or other documents that might provide information about the string or its components.
  5. Contact the Manufacturer or Vendor: If you're unable to decipher the string on your own, try contacting the manufacturer or vendor of the product or system. They may be able to provide information about the meaning of the string, especially if it's related to a specific product or service.
  6. Use Online Tools: There are various online tools and resources that can help you decipher unknown strings. These include online dictionaries, abbreviation finders, and code decoders. Try using these tools to see if they can provide any insights into the meaning of the string.
  7. Ask for Help: If you're still stuck, don't hesitate to ask for help from others. Post the string in online forums, technical communities, or social media groups and see if anyone can help you decipher it. Be sure to provide as much context as possible to help others understand the string and its potential meaning.
